The New York State Lottery has decided to change its slogan. We’ve all come to know and love “Hey, you never know” but the lottery decided it needs something new. The new slogan is the spearhead of a new publicity campaign which started in May. The message is simple, “Be ready” and it means that all the people who buy lottery tickets should be prepared in the eventuality of a prize. The new slogan will not replace the old one. Instead, the “Good things can happen in an instant” will be used together with “Be ready”.
The message of the campaign is that it only takes a second to win one of the massive jackpots offered by the games designed by the New York Lottery. Radio and TV commercials are included in the $9 million budget of the new publicity campaign. According to statistics, the New York Lottery uses $30-40 million on advertisement every year. “We introduce 30 or 40 instant games a year,” Gordon Medenica, New York Lottery director, stated, “there’s a total of 60 to 70 in our inventory.”
The lottery is focused a lot on instant games, which have brought more revenue in the last fiscal year than draw games. $3.5 billion were brought in by instant games, while drawings only brought in $3.2 billion. Medenica says that is so because with the big drawings, like the Powerball or Mega Millions, everything is focusing on the big prize, which claims about two thirds of the funds. On the other hand, for instant scratch games, “80 percent of the prize fund does not go to the top prizes.” Lotteries
Also, it appears that while draws give out around 50 percent of the total funding, “in an instant, it’s 65 or 70 percent in prizes.”
“It’s a bit of a black art deciding which games to support before we have an idea of how they do,” Medenica said. Lottery results
